Peach Pie Strain Information and Characteristics
-
Strain TypeStrain Type:
Peach Pie is an indica-dominant hybrid with a dessert profile. It pairs body relaxation with a mild cerebral lift.
-
THC ContentTHC Content:
Flower tests show THC around 18 to 22 percent. This level matches many popular Canadian hybrids.
-
CBD ContentCBD Content:
Peach Pie has low CBD, typically under 1 percent. Low CBD makes the strain suited for THC-driven symptom relief.
-
Grow DifficultyGrow Difficulty:
Growing Peach Pie rates moderate in difficulty. You will need routine pruning and steady feeding.
-
Flowering TimeFlowering Time:
Flowering runs eight to nine weeks indoors. Outdoor harvest often lands in late September in temperate regions.
-
Expected YieldExpected Yield:
Indoor yields reach 400 to 550 g per square metre with trained plants. Outdoor plants often produce 400 to 700 g per plant in good seasons.
-
Plant HeightPlant Height:
Plants grow to medium height, about 80 to 140 cm indoors. Outdoor specimens may reach 1.6 metres under full sun.
-
Growing EnvironmentGrowing Environment:
Peach Pie suits both indoor and outdoor setups. You will prefer a controlled indoor environment for resin and aroma.
-
Expected EffectsExpected Effects:
Expect a relaxed body feel with a gentle uplift. Users report calm focus followed by sleepiness at higher doses.
-
Genetic LineageGenetic Lineage:
Genetics read Wedding Cake x Grape Pie. The cross produces dessert-forward terpenes and balanced effects.
-
Seed TypeSeed Type:
These seeds are offered feminized for predictable female crops. You will find stable pheno with seed selection and veg time.
-
Preferred ClimatePreferred Climate:
Best climate runs temperate to Mediterranean with a dry late season. In cooler Canadian zones you will prefer a greenhouse or indoor finish.

Q: How should I dry and cure buds?
A: Hang branches in a dark room at 18 C and 50 percent humidity. Dry slowly over 7 to 10 days then cure in jars.
